8. The Stories We Tell to Protect Ourselves

from Maps of Orientation: Awareness, Belief, and the Unexamined Mind · host Only Life After All

Human beings like to think of self-deception as something rare.A dishonest politician.A manipulative partner.A corrupt executive.A propagandist knowingly spreading falsehoods.But most self-deception is quieter than that.Far more ordinary.Far more human.Most people are not consciously lying to themselves all day long. In fact, the most powerful forms of self-deception often operate precisely because the individual experiences themselves as sincere.The mind protects coherence automatically.This protection begins early and continues throughout life.
